Page MenuHomePhabricator

Requirements gathering for Superset and Turnilo
Closed, DeclinedPublic

Description

Goal: for changes that we can do to Superset to make it user friendly and intuitive

Things like definitions, naming standards, dashboard standards, guides, dictionaries…

  • Identify key questions to ask, such as: why do they use Superset, what have they felt could be nicer, what would make them more likely to use it, what are the pain points?
  • Survey/interview PMs:

Related: See T300908

Event Timeline

LGoto triaged this task as Medium priority.Jun 30 2020, 7:43 PM
LGoto edited projects, added Product-Analytics (Kanban); removed Product-Analytics.

We've been able to get a few recommendations from stakeholders as a part of the Content Dataset Questionnaire.

On a related note, have you used Superset or Turnilo and felt like it could do with some improvements ? Please let us know one change you would like to see in these reporting dashboards to make your experience better.

  • Turnilo has been super useful for me. Two main limitations I faced: (1) requiring log-in limits our ability to share data with communities, and (2) calculating deletion ratios requires manual calculation from the data Turnillo provides.
  • There are two main things for me: (1) the "editors" dataset will be the most important one for the Growth team because our metrics and goals are all around editors, as opposed to edits or content, and (2) I hope we can continue to reduce how long it takes data to appear. I would use Turnilo and Superset much more frequently (and would avoid making separate reports) if the data were to update daily.
  • easier discovery of existing dashboard
  • More regular updates of the turnilo "edits-hourly" table (see https://phabricator.wikimedia.org/T231938)
  • I would like a toggle button to turn from charts into tabular data. When you have a lot of languages listed at once (e.g., https://superset.wikimedia.org/superset/dashboard/161 ) it's impossible to really get a handle on what's going on in chart format. Give me a table any day.
  • the ability to define segments and have that show up in superset or turnilo. one example is on the projects. I'd like to create a list of small/medium/large wikis and break those out when analyzing the pageviews table.

Moving this to Backlog, to pick up after I get back from Parental Leave (in dec)

Aklapper added subscribers: Mayakp.wiki, Aklapper.

Removing task assignee due to inactivity as this open task has been assigned for more than two years. See the email sent to the task assignee on August 22nd, 2022.
Please assign this task to yourself again if you still realistically [plan to] work on this task - it would be welcome!
If this task has been resolved in the meantime, or should not be worked on ("declined"), please update its task status via "Add Action… 🡒 Change Status".
Also see https://www.mediawiki.org/wiki/Bug_management/Assignee_cleanup for tips how to best manage your individual work in Phabricator. Thanks!

nshahquinn-wmf subscribed.

This looks defunct.